Transaction 24ff7819903a4781ebe489ff91bafc1c28a949dfab373eae07ea086289102a0c
1 Input
1 Output
-
24ff7819903a4781ebe489ff91bafc1c28a949dfab373eae07ea086289102a0c:0
- value
- 455321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5f362904a17c760c03796cbf867253e7d379bd4 OP_EQUAL
- address
- 3MCHR6Dyz5cFLJgTjFF24c3k5dX17uRzsK